Features

X-NUCLEO-IHM16M1
Three-phase driver board for BLDC/PMSM motors based on
Nominal operating voltage range from 7 V dc to 45 V dc
Output current up to 1.5 A rms
Overcurrent, short-circuit, and interlocking protections
Thermal shutdown and under-voltage lockout
BEMF sensing circuitry
Support of 3-shunt or 1-shunt motor current sensing
Hall-effect-based sensors or encoder input connector
Potentiometer available for speed regulation
Equipped with ST morpho connectors

Three-phase motor:
Gimbal motor: GBM2804H-100T
Maximum DC voltage: 14.8 V
Maximum rotational speed: 2180 rpm
Maximum torque: 0.981 N·m
Maximum DC current: 5 A
Number of pole pairs: 7
DC power supply:
Nominal output voltage: 12 V dc
Maximum output current: 2 A
Input voltage range: from 100 V ac to 240 V ac
Frequency range: from 50 Hz to 60 Hz
